Urg. That's no help. You need to get the faulting PC somehow. On a
Windows NT machine you could extract that from C:\WINNT\DRWATSON.LOG
(IIRC). I have no idea what the equivalent is on Windows 98 though.
Did you build with boehm-gc? If so, does a "make check" in boehm-gc run
to completion?
